什么是TFB技术它如何改进网页加载速度

什么是TFB技术,它如何改进网页加载速度?

什么是TFB技术它如何改进网页加载速度

TFB技术简介

TFB,全称为Time to First Byte,即首次字节时间。它是指从用户发起请求到浏览器接收到第一个字节的时间。TFB是一个重要的性能指标,它直接反映了服务器响应请求的速度。在网页优化中,降低TFB可以有效提升用户体验,提高网站的加载速度。

TFB技术如何改进网页加载速度

1. 优化服务器性能

提高服务器硬件配置:升级CPU、内存、硬盘等硬件设备,提升服务器处理请求的能力。

优化服务器软件:使用更高效的Web服务器软件,如Nginx、Apache等,以减少处理请求的时间。

2. 减少服务器端处理时间

代码优化:对服务器端代码进行优化,减少不必要的数据库查询、循环等,提高代码执行效率。

缓存机制:利用缓存技术,将用户请求频繁访问的数据存储在服务器或本地,减少数据库查询次数。

3. 优化网络传输

使用CDN(内容分发网络):将静态资源部署到全球多个节点,根据用户地理位置智能选择最优节点,减少数据传输距离。

压缩资源:对图片、CSS、JavaScript等资源进行压缩,减少文件大小,提高加载速度。

4. 减少HTTP请求次数

合并资源:将多个CSS、JavaScript文件合并为一个,减少HTTP请求次数。

使用懒加载:对非首屏显示的内容,如图片、视频等,采用懒加载技术,仅在用户滚动到相应位置时加载。

5. 优化数据库查询

查询优化:优化数据库查询语句,减少查询时间。

数据库索引:为数据库表创建索引,提高查询效率。

常见问题清单及解答

1. 什么是TFB?

TFB是指从用户发起请求到浏览器接收到第一个字节的时间,是衡量网页加载速度的一个重要指标。

2. 如何测量TFB?

可以使用浏览器的开发者工具、第三方性能测试工具或在线TFB测试网站来测量TFB。

3. TFB与页面加载速度有何关系?

TFB是页面加载速度的一个组成部分,降低TFB可以显著提高页面加载速度。

4. 为什么TFB重要?

TFB反映了服务器响应速度,对于用户体验和搜索引擎优化(SEO)都有重要影响。

5. 如何优化TFB?

优化服务器性能、减少服务器端处理时间、优化网络传输、减少HTTP请求次数、优化数据库查询等。

6. 如何提高服务器性能?

提高服务器硬件配置、优化服务器软件、使用更高效的数据库管理系统等。

7. 如何减少服务器端处理时间?

代码优化、使用缓存机制、减少数据库查询次数等。

8. 如何优化网络传输?

使用CDN、压缩资源、优化HTTP请求等。

9. 如何减少HTTP请求次数?

合并资源、使用懒加载等。

10. 如何优化数据库查询?

查询优化、创建索引等。

版权声明:如无特殊标注,文章均来自网络,本站编辑整理,转载时请以链接形式注明文章出处,请自行分辨。

本文链接:https://www.fvrkz.cn/qukuailian/7068.html